Brand Equity And Market Positioning
Estee Lauder Companies Net Worth reflects decades of brand building, celebrity endorsement, and precision marketing. Each label within the portfolio contributes to an overall halo effect that reinforces premium pricing power.
High visibility campaigns and strategic department store placements ensure that prestige signals remain tightly aligned with consumer aspiration, which in turn supports resilient net worth even during economic uncertainty.
Growth Drivers And Innovation Pipeline
Heavy investment in research, sustainability initiatives, and personalization technology continuously refreshes the product pipeline. New launches in skincare science, fragrance, and color cosmetics create incremental demand and justify higher price points.
Digital laboratories, augmented reality try on tools, and data driven customization strengthen customer loyalty and increase average order value across channels.
Competitive Landscape And Risk Factors
While Estee Lauder Companies Net Worth remains strong, competition from niche indie brands and aggressive digital native labels requires constant vigilance. Regulatory changes, currency fluctuations, and geopolitical tensions in key regions add layers of complexity to future projections.
Supply chain resilience, responsible sourcing, and transparent reporting on diversity governance are increasingly material to long term valuation and institutional confidence.

What role does digital transformation play in preserving and growing net worth?
Investments in ecommerce, first party data, and integrated commerce platforms help capture margin that would otherwise be shared with third party retailers, while deepening direct consumer relationships for long term value.
